#include <stdio.h>
#include <string.h>
#include <ctype.h>
#include <ns_api.h>
#include <ns_daemon.h>
#include "ns_files.h"
#ident "$Revision: 1.6 $"
static int
file_macByName(nsd_file_t *rq)
{
char *key;
char *line;
char *colon;
file_domain_t *dom;
size_t len;
int (*cmpfunc)(const char *, const char *, size_t);
/*
** Open the label file if not already done.
*/
dom = file_domain_lookup(rq);
if (! dom) {
rq->f_status = NS_NOTFOUND;
return NSD_NEXT;
}
/*
** Start at the beginning and do a linear seach for the key.
*/
key = nsd_attr_fetch_string(rq->f_attrs, "key", (char *)0);
if (! key) {
rq->f_status = NS_FATAL;
return NSD_ERROR;
}
len = strlen(key);
if (len == 0) {
rq->f_status = NS_FATAL;
return NSD_ERROR;
}
if (nsd_attr_fetch_bool(rq->f_attrs, "casefold", FALSE)) {
cmpfunc = strncasecmp;
} else {
cmpfunc = strncmp;
}
for (line = dom->map; line && *line; line = strchr(line + 1, '\n')) {
SKIPWSPACE(line);
if (! *line || *line == '#')
continue;
colon = strchr(line, ':');
if (colon == NULL)
break;
colon = strchr(colon + 1, ':');
if (colon == NULL)
break;
if ((colon - line) == len) {
if ((cmpfunc)(key, line, len) == 0) {
len = strcspn(line, "\n");
nsd_set_result(rq, NS_SUCCESS, line,
len, VOLATILE);
nsd_append_result(rq, NS_SUCCESS, "\n",
sizeof("\n"));
return NSD_OK;
}
}
}
rq->f_status = NS_NOTFOUND;
return NSD_NEXT;
}
static int
file_macByValue(nsd_file_t *rq)
{
char *key;
char *line;
file_domain_t *dom;
size_t len;
int (*cmpfunc)(const char *, const char *, size_t);
/*
** Open the label file if not already done.
*/
dom = file_domain_lookup(rq);
if (! dom) {
rq->f_status = NS_NOTFOUND;
return NSD_NEXT;
}
/*
** Start at the beginning and do a linear seach for the key.
*/
key = nsd_attr_fetch_string(rq->f_attrs, "key", (char *)0);
if (! key) {
rq->f_status = NS_FATAL;
return NSD_ERROR;
}
len = strlen(key);
if (len == 0) {
rq->f_status = NS_FATAL;
return NSD_ERROR;
}
if (nsd_attr_fetch_bool(rq->f_attrs, "casefold", FALSE)) {
cmpfunc = strncasecmp;
} else {
cmpfunc = strncmp;
}
for (line = dom->map; line && *line; line = strchr(line + 1, '\n')) {
char *p;
SKIPWSPACE(line);
if (! *line || *line == '#')
continue;
for (p = line; *p != '\0'; p++) {
if (*p == '\n')
break;
if (*p == ':') {
if ((cmpfunc)(key, p + 1, len) == 0) {
len = strcspn(line, "\n");
nsd_set_result(rq, NS_SUCCESS, line,
len, VOLATILE);
nsd_append_result(rq, NS_SUCCESS,
"\n", sizeof("\n"));
return NSD_OK;
}
break;
}
}
}
rq->f_status = NS_NOTFOUND;
return NSD_NEXT;
}
int
file_mac_lookup(nsd_file_t *rq)
{
char *map;
if (! rq) {
return NSD_ERROR;
}
map = nsd_attr_fetch_string(rq->f_attrs, "table", (char *)0);
if (! map) {
return NSD_ERROR;
}
if (strcasecmp(map, MAC_BYNAME) == 0) {
return file_macByName(rq);
} else {
return file_macByValue(rq);
}
}
int
file_mac_list(nsd_file_t *rq)
{
file_domain_t *dom;
if (! rq) {
return NSD_ERROR;
}
dom = file_domain_lookup(rq);
if (! dom) {
rq->f_status = NS_NOTFOUND;
return NSD_NEXT;
}
nsd_append_element(rq, NS_SUCCESS, dom->map, dom->size);
if (dom->map[dom->size - 1] != '\n') {
nsd_append_result(rq, NS_SUCCESS, "\n", sizeof("\n"));
}
return NSD_NEXT;
}
